NY Next Generation Math NY-4.MD.5.b
The Standard
Recognize an angle that turns through n one-degree angles is said to have an angle measure of n degrees.

What This Standard Means
What Students Need to Do
- Students understand that an angle measuring n degrees is composed of n one-degree turns. They connect the numerical measure to the amount of rotation between the rays.
What Mastery Looks Like
- A student explains that a 65-degree angle contains 65 one-degree turns from one ray to the other. The student knows that increasing the number of one-degree turns increases the angle measure.
Common Misconceptions
- Students may count drawn tick marks without treating each interval as one degree or use ray length to decide the measure. They may confuse the degree count with a fraction's numerator or denominator.
How to Assess It
- Show an angle represented as 35 consecutive one-degree turns. Ask students to state its measure and explain what the number 35 counts.
Lesson moves
Ways to Teach It
Build angles by rotating a ray through labeled one-degree intervals on a circular template, then record each measure.
Ask students what changes when ten more one-degree turns are added to an angle.
Play degree-count match with angle diagrams, one-degree turn counts, and numerical measures.
Track the degree turn of a rotating sign or wheel pointer between two marked positions.
